Show Info

Genre(s): Comedy, Sci-Fi & Fantasy

Created By: Josh Schwartz

First Air Date: January 10, 2010

Summary

Starring Zachary Levi, Yvonne Strahovski, Adam Baldwin, Joshua Gomez, Sarah Lancaster, Ryan McPartlin, Vik Sahay, Scott Krinsky, and Mark Christopher Lawrence

Chuck's access to all the knowledge in his brain helps him join the upper spy ranks with Sarah, but it's not bringing them any closer.
